Members of the Erode Urban District Congress Committee on Wednesday (April 16, 2025) sent 50 letters to the Indian President of the Murmo, which demanded that the WAQF change law be abolished.
Congress cadre led by the President of the Committee T. Thiruselvam said that the act that was approved in parliament has recently received presidential consent. They argued that the act of undermining the autonomy of WAQF properties and facilitating the seizure of countries used by members of the Muslim community.
According to them, it provides an amendment to the district collector to determine whether the property is the property of WAQF or not – the responsibility previously resolved by the WAQF court. They also stated that the permission of non -Muslim members on the WAQF councils is unacceptable because the Constitution guarantees the community of freedom of self -government. The letters urged the president to cancel the act to ensure that the community members would live without fear.
